A beloved community hub, the Jamestown Mercantile, faces extinction unless 1.5 million dollars is raised in 11 months—thanks to a crowdfunding campaign that’s only hit $33K so far from 130 donors. With quirky charm, historic character, and a “living room” vibe, the Merc is more than bricks and mortar—it’s a free-spirited gathering spot threatened by developers who could turn it into high-end condos or pricey restaurants. Musician Gregory Alan Isakov is helping by donating a dollar per ticket sold. The clock’s ticking, but locals are rallying to save this irreplaceable mountain gem before it’s lost forever.
